
Nikos Christodulides
Nikos Christodulides is the current President of Cyprus, having assumed office in February 2023. He previously served as the Minister of Foreign Affairs, where he focused on strengthening Cyprus's international relations and addressing key issues related to the division of the island. Christodulides has been involved in diplomatic efforts aimed at resolving the longstanding conflict between the Greek Cypriots and Turkish Cypriots. His recent participation in talks in New York, which were labeled as 'constructive' by UN Secretary-General António Guterres, highlights his commitment to fostering dialogue and seeking solutions for cross-border cooperation on the divided island.
